Chapter 13
A chapter under the United States Bankruptcy Code, allowing individuals earning a regular income to develop a plan to repay all or part of their debts.
Unsecured Creditor
A creditor who extended credit without requiring specific collateral, and thus ranks behind secured creditors in claiming repayment in the event of debtor insolvency.
Chapter 7 Liquidations
A bankruptcy process where a debtor's assets are liquidated or sold off by a trustee to pay off creditors, leading to the discharge of remaining debts.
